Choosing Home program helps older Veterans

(07/30/2026) VA researchers in Providence and Boston interviewed Veterans and caregivers participating in a new home care program, finding it improved their health, self-management, and caregiver effectiveness. Choose Home is an interdisciplinary, short-term home-care program designed to support Veterans at risk of losing independence. In a group of participating Veterans, 85% felt they were doing better at home, 90% felt more able to manage their VA care, and 89% were satisfied with the program. Open-ended survey questions revealed strengths of the program, including promoting aging in place by fostering autonomy and dignity; holistic care during health crises through coordinated support; and caregiver empowerment through education, relief, and practical assistance. The responses show Choosing Home could help aging Veterans stay independent and in their homes longer. (Journal of the American Geriatrics Society, Jul. 16, 2026)
